Job Summary:
The Catering Coordinator provides administrative support to the Catering and Convention Services Department.DutiesPoint-of-contact for other system users; and assisting them with user issues. Coordinating with Newmarket to set-up logins for new users. Assisting new users with basic training of Delphi program after becoming “certified” to use the booking system. Communicating with Newmarket to report and request assistance with resolving program-related issues. Keeping the Director of Catering informed of all issues that arise. Keeping menus, prices, set-up and audio/visual items updated in the system, as information is made available.Types letters and other correspondence from verbal instructions, e.g., memos, special requests forms, gift certificate requests, JTO group contracts and menus, etc. Makes copies of paperwork and distributes.Answers, handles, and directs telephone calls and inquiries for food and beverage, as needed. Includes checking availability and booking new banquet reservations in system.Reconciles revenue information between banquet chits (actuals) and event information in the Catering Booking System (Delphi); updates account files as needed, reports discrepancies to necessary departments and Catering Manager; and resolves issues as needed.Prepares, generates, copy, and/or delivers Banquet Event Orders and guarantees to required department(s). Prepares estimate invoices, as needed for clients. Receives and posts payments for Banquet events; and prepares receipts. Generates reports from Delphi as needed.Maintains organized files and file paperwork daily. Prepares file folders for all events.Assists in obtaining ‘guarantee counts’ for food functions sold prior to the function.Assists Director of Catering with other projects, as assigned.SkillsEnsure that all information is kept confidential, unless otherwise advised.Ensure that all Occupational Health and Safety requirements for the company are met within your department.
